Overall Meaning

The lyrics of Gregory Isaacs's "All I Have Is Love" speaks to the idea that love is the most important thing in a relationship, rather than material possessions or lavish experiences. The song suggests that some men may try to win a woman's affection by showering her with expensive gifts, but the singer is not able to do that. Instead, he professes his love and explains that despite not having the financial means to offer her anything else, his love should be enough.


Isaacs says that though he might not be rich, he truly loves this woman and that should be what's most important. He suggests that if she doesn't understand or appreciate that sentiment, then she can leave because all he has to give is love. The singer's voice is filled with emotion and sincerity, making the lyrics even more impactful. He sings the chorus throughout the song, emphasizing the idea that all he has to offer is love.


This song is a classic example of how love and affection can transcend material possessions or money. It tells the story of a man who may not be able to buy fancy gifts, but is able to offer his love and devotion. The lyrics are simple but powerful and will resonate with anyone who values love over material possessions.
